What affects the price

Choosing an electric fireplace involves several variables that influence your final investment. Generally, basic wall-mounted units are the most budget-friendly options. Prices typically rise when you select built-in models that require framing, or units featuring advanced flame technology and realistic ember beds. The size of the fireplace, the heat output capacity, and the materials used for the surround—like stone, wood, or metal finishes—also play a major role in the overall cost. Whether you want a simple plug-in insert or a custom-designed media console, the features you prioritize will determine your total. About this service

Dimplex is a manufacturer of high-end electric fireboxes that fit into existing masonry or wood-burning fireplaces. You need this if you have an old fireplace that you no longer want to use for wood but still want to keep as a focal point. These inserts offer realistic flame technology. Many people assume fireplaces are only for cold weather, but electric models offer year-round aesthetic benefits. During the summer, you can turn off the heating element entirely and simply enjoy the ambiance of the dancing flames. It adds a sophisticated touch to your decor during evening gatherings without adding any unwanted warmth.

What kind of problems can electric fireplaces have that need fixing in Raleigh?

Electric fireplaces in Raleigh can sometimes have issues with heating elements, flame effect lights, or remote controls. You might notice the heater not working or the flame effect flickering oddly. Sometimes, the unit might not turn on at all. Getting professional help ensures these issues are diagnosed and fixed correctly. Do electric fireplaces need regular service in Raleigh?

While electric fireplaces don't require chimney sweeping like wood-burning ones, they can benefit from occasional service in Raleigh. This ensures all components, like the heater and flame generator, are working optimally. Professionals can perform checks for dust buildup or minor electrical issues. Regular maintenance can help prolong the life of your unit and keep it running efficiently. It's a good idea to have them inspected periodically.
